General Overview of Safe Superintelligence Inc (SSI)

Safe Superintelligence Inc, better known as SSI, is an innovative startup specializing in the development of secure general artificial intelligence (AGI) systems. Recently founded by notable figures in the AI industry, including Ilya Sutskever, Daniel Gross, and Daniel Levy, SSI stands out for its commitment to creating a superintelligence that is both high-performing and secure. With offices in Palo Alto and Tel Aviv, SSI benefits from a strategic position that allows it to recruit the best technical talents in the sector.

Areas of Expertise and Key Achievements

SSI focuses exclusively on the research and development of secure superintelligence. The company was born from the vision of its founders, who believe that human-level, or even superior, artificial intelligence could be developed before the end of this decade. Their approach emphasizes the security and alignment of AI systems with human values to prevent any potential risks to humanity. The decision not to commercialize any product until their systems are deemed completely safe demonstrates their commitment to ethical and responsible AI.

Recent Contributions and Notable Projects

Since its inception, SSI has quickly attracted the attention of the tech community and investors. The startup raised one billion dollars during its first funding round, supported by major players like Andreessen Horowitz and Sequoia Capital. These funds are intended to strengthen their research and development capacity by acquiring computing power and recruiting top-tier engineers and researchers. SSI plans to dedicate several years to research before launching products on the market, thereby ensuring the safety and efficiency of their AI systems.

Position in the Technological Ecosystem

SSI positions itself as a key player in the AI domain, directly competing with established companies like OpenAI. The launch of SSI coincided with Ilya Sutskever's departure from OpenAI, where he was co-founder and chief scientist. This departure highlights the differences in vision between Sutskever and OpenAI, particularly regarding security priorities in AGI development. SSI distinguishes itself with its security-focused approach, aiming to set new standards in the AI industry.

Recent Developments and News

Recently, SSI announced the launch of its research lab in Tel Aviv, underscoring its commitment to innovation and international expansion. The startup continues to actively recruit to build a team of researchers and engineers dedicated to its singular mission: developing a safe superintelligence. In parallel, SSI works closely with security experts to ensure that its systems remain aligned with human and ethical values.
